Summary
- Design, maintain, and support the company’s database infrastructure.
- Ensure data integrity, availability, and performance optimisation.
- Implement database backups, disaster recovery procedures, and security measures.
- Collaborate with development teams to optimise database performance and queries.
- Monitor system performance, diagnose and troubleshoot database issues.
Key Skills
- Proficient in database management systems (e.g., MySQL, PostgreSQL, Oracle, MSSQL).
- Experience in database tuning and performance optimisation.
- Familiarity with database backup and recovery procedures.
- Strong understanding of database structures, principles, and best practices.
- Excellent problem-solving skills and attention to detail.
Standard Industry Training
- Certifications related to specific database technologies (e.g., Oracle DBA Certification, Microsoft SQL Server Certification).
Interview Questions:
- How do you handle a situation where the database performance suddenly drops?
- Describe a time when you had to recover data from a backup. What was the situation and how did you handle it?
- How do you ensure the security of sensitive data in the database?
- What are your strategies for database scaling and replication?
- Explain the difference between normalisation and denormalisation.
DOWNLOAD PD TEMPLATE
Register My Interest in this Position